If you get a chance, read last week’s Barrons roundtable interview with Marc Faber. He was very bearish on emerging markets 7 years ago when they were peaking. He says conditions, although not perfect, have changed significantly for the better. Faber is now bullish and expecting the average emerging market to return 100% in short order. These markets are down an average 80% in dollar terms from their peaks. He also mentioned that Mark Mobius, the manager of Templeton Emerging Markets (NYSE: EMF), was expecting a bull market to result in 500% to 600% returns in these stocks. Last week this fund had a moving average crossover (50 day crossing the 200 day) which is very bullish technically. I’ve taken significant positions in several emerging market closed-end funds including EMF over the past 6 months. However, the discount to NAV is not enticing on this fund now, so I’ll be loading up the boat in several others that are selling at discounts approaching 20% (MSF, TCH and TDF are on my radar).
